Bargaining with the Tide
Documentary
A documentary examining redevelopment plans for the Brooklyn Marine Terminal and the community opposition they have generated — weighing affordable housing, environmental impact, and the future of the working waterfront. A work-in-progress screening was held in 2025, with release anticipated in 2026.
